Summary

Airweave

Comfort

"A comfortable mattress ensures a deep sleep. Airweave, Tuft and Needle and HIBR all are comfortable sleep surfaces. However, the choice depends on your sleeping position and comfort level preferences. For a plush feel, Airweave is an excellent choice while for a firmer feel, you may want to check out Tuft and Needle or HIBR. "

Tuft and Needle

Support

"Tuft and Needle and Airweave are more adaptable to people with heavyweight than the skinny people. The heavy layered structure is built to support people weighing over 200lbs. Lightweight people might like HIBR better as its plush structure fits perfectly to the body curves and provides adequate pain relief to pressure points."

Tuft and Needle

Temperature regulation

"Tuft and Needle is made up of materials that retain heat during the night. If you tend to sweat while you slumber, you may want to go for Airweave or HIBR as they contain proper temperature regulation mechanism. These two mattresses offer a chill surface for a refreshing sleep. "
